Gavi addressed his recent clash with Vinicius Jr during Barcelona's 2-0 Clasico win, stating he told Vinicius to 'shut his mouth.' He emphasized that on-field tensions are separate from off-field relationships.
“Vinicius is just football. What happens on the pitch stays on the pitch. He’s a hot-headed player, just like me. Vinicius is a fantastic player. I told him to shut his mouth, and that’s it,” he told reporters.

“What happens on the pitch is one thing, and what happens off it is another. On the pitch, I defend my colors and give it my all. Off the pitch, I’m completely different, even if it doesn’t seem like it.” Gavi also spoke about Ousmane Dembele following the Frenchman’s midweek message on social media after PSG’s Champions League win over Bayern. “Ousmane is my brother. Since I arrived here, he’s always been like a brother to me,” he added.
“He’s a very good friend of mine. We’re in close contact, we talk all the time, and I’m very happy for him because he’s one of the best in the world, if not the best along with Lamine.” Sunday was another good night for Gavi as he was once again named in the starting XI by Flick and put in another strong showing. The midfielder is finishing the season well after his long injury lay-off and will be hoping he is playing his way into the Spain squad for World Cup 2026.
